Frequently Asked Questions

What are all the color codes for HSL(345, 70%, 40%)?

HEX: #AD1F42 | RGB: rgb(173, 31, 66) | CMYK: 0%, 82%, 62%, 32% | HSV: 345°, 82%, 68%. Copy any format from the conversion table above.

What colors go well with #AD1F42?

The complementary color is HSL(165, 70%, 40%). For a triadic harmony, use hues 345°, 105°, and 225°. For analogous combinations, try hues 315° and 15°. See the Color Harmony section above for complete palettes with previews.

How do I use HSL(345, 70%, 40%) in CSS?

As HSL: color: hsl(345, 70%, 40%); — As HEX: color: #AD1F42; — As RGB: color: rgb(173, 31, 66); — Tailwind CSS: bg-[hsl(345,70%,40%)] — CSS variable: --color-primary: hsl(345, 70%, 40%);
